From 5 to 7 July, for the fourth year, it returns to Bari Seafront Of Books. The municipal council has in fact approved the holding of the cultural event which, as is now tradition, is hosted in the old city and along the Wall, from Largo Vito Maurogiovanni to Fortino Sant’Antonio, up to Piazza del Ferrarese. The Apulian capital will therefore be transformed into an open-air bookshop thanks to the presence of local booksellers and publishers, but also of authors from all over Italy. The theme chosen is ‘The memory of the sea’, as the Municipality explains in a note, that is «a metaphor of mobility, travel, adventure and migration and an opportunity to reflect on a series of dichotomies such as emerged and submerged, surface and abyss, fear and fun.”
25 bookstores involved
Around 25 bookshops in the Bari area and over thirty publishers from Puglia are taking part in the event, plus many guests to discuss books and emerging themes of contemporary literature. Lungomare di Libri is promoted by the Municipality of Bari in collaboration with the Presìdi del libro association, with the support of the Puglia Region and the organizational support of the Turin International Book Fair. «Authors will return to Bari with their stories – explains Piero Crocenzi, managing director of the Book Fair -. It is always valuable for the Salon to bring its voice outside of Piedmont, involving booksellers, publishers and the entire publishing chain in occasions of debate for readers from all over Italy.”
